Summary:This paper provides a review of Mali’s economic performance under the Extended Credit Facility (ECF) and requests for extension, augmentation of access, and modification of performance criteria. The political situation has continued to stabilize, following the signing of the peace agreement in June 2015. On the macroeconomic side, the recovery continued in 2015, with strong GDP growth, low inflation, and strengthening of the fiscal position. Overall, program implementation in 2015 was strong. All performance criteria and indicative targets for the fifth review were observed, generally with significant margins. The authorities are requesting a one-year extension of the current ECF arrangement, to December 2017
